
Whether you're new to baking or well seasoned, this book club is the perfect place to meet fellow bakers, try new recipes and share both the successes and failures of your bakes. We will bake from and discuss a different cookbook every month. Limited copies of the book will be available to check out in advance at the main Nepean Centerpointe library hub - just ask one of the staff for a copy of the baking club cookbook. Sessions will be held on the first Thursday of the month at 6:30pm to 7:45pm. All are welcome! Here's what we're baking in 2026: January 8th: Anything goes! Bake a recipe of your choice and bring the recipe with you to discuss! February 5th: Sally's Baking 101 by Sally McKenney March 5th: Not Too Sweet by Jessica Seinfeld April 2nd: Gluten Free Baking! Bake from a gluten-free book of your choice. May 7th: Crave by Carolyne McIntyre Jackson June 4th: Summer Baking - Bake any recipe that reminds you of summer and bring the recipe with you to discuss!
